A popular option in the state, Progressive insures about 14% of Idaho drivers on the road.[1] The company offers some of the lowest annual premiums for full coverage and minimum coverage in the state.
Progressive is a good option for all your insurance needs. It’s one of the few insurers to offer snowmobile insurance — perfect for snow sports enthusiasts.

State Farm insures slightly more residents than Progressive in Idaho, making it the top car insurance company by market share in the state. Working with a large insurer like State Farm means you can rest assured it’ll take care of your claims.
State Farm is one of the most financially stable car insurance companies on the market today. Plus, it offers numerous ways to save on your policy.

USAA has a good reputation for providing cheap car insurance and good customer service for most of its members. Idaho is home to roughly 3,500 active-duty soldiers, 5,200 reservists, and 118,000 veterans, who should qualify for membership with USAA.[2] It offers many military-specific discounts for young and old drivers alike.

You can get minimum liability coverage consistent with Idaho state laws from Amica, but it has unique premium-level car insurance packages. The company’s Platinum Choice plan includes things like deductible-free glass coverage and credit monitoring. Special touches like that are what help it stand out among Idaho auto owners.

Drivers with violations on their records often struggle to get cheap car insurance in Idaho, but Direct Auto can help. It offers competitive rates for second-chance Idaho drivers and numerous discounts, including for drivers younger than 21 and senior drivers older than 55.

How to get the best car insurance in Idaho
Following the tips below can help you save money on the car insurance Idaho requires all drivers to buy. See how you can save on coverage.
Revisit your coverage limits and types
Choosing a policy with the minimum coverage for bodily injury and property damage liability is one of the easiest ways to get cheap car insurance. Lenders usually require you to purchase higher coverage limits on your vehicle, so you can’t do this if you have an auto loan or lease.
A lower coverage limit is only appropriate if you can afford to pay extra costs out of pocket if needed. If you have a new or expensive car, for example, you should consider getting more robust coverage.
Improve your credit
Having good credit can help you get more than just low average rates on loans. It can help you earn more affordable annual premiums on car insurance. Companies in Idaho can consider your credit-based insurance score when determining premiums, so healthy credit can help you save on coverage.
Try setting your bills on auto pay so you don’t miss any payments, and focus on paying down high-interest debt to build your credit.
Compare car insurance quotes
Comparing quotes from multiple insurers is the best way to find cheap car insurance. It’s a good way to help you determine the best car insurance option for your needs. Experts recommend checking rates every time your insurance policy is up for renewal to get the best premiums.[3]
Even though Idaho auto owners pay a low average rate for car insurance compared to the rest of the country, you can always try to save more.
Look for relevant discounts
Many insurers offer specific car insurance discounts that Idaho drivers can easily qualify for. Common discounts reward drivers for completing a defensive driving course, maintaining a clean record, operating a safe vehicle, bundling two or more coverages, and more.
Average cost of car insurance in Idaho
Idaho auto owners live in a relatively inexpensive state for car insurance. Residents pay an average rate of $68 per month for liability coverage and $126 for full coverage.
In contrast, drivers nationwide pay an average of $105 per month for liability and $197 for full coverage.

What is the required auto insurance coverage amount in Idaho?
State law requires all Idaho drivers to carry minimum coverage amounts of $25,000 per person and $50,000 per accident in bodily injury liability protection and $15,000 in property damage liability protection. Insurers must also automatically include uninsured and underinsured motorist coverage, but Idaho drivers have the option to decline this coverage in writing.[4]
